The captivating print titled "A Scene from The Maid of the Mill" by John Inigo Richards takes us back to 18th-century England, showcasing the talent and creativity of this British artist. Painted on canvas with oil, Richards masterfully captures a picturesque scene filled with life and emotion. In the foreground, we see a charming cottage nestled amidst a farmyard, surrounded by a rustic fence. The stage-like composition draws our attention to the lively characters within the frame. Men and women are engaged in various activities - some conversing near an open window, others tending to their daily chores in the yard. The artist's attention to detail is evident in every stroke of his brush. Wispy clouds float above, casting soft shadows over the landscape while adding depth to the overall composition. A water wheel can be seen nearby, hinting at its significance for sustenance and industry during that era. Richards' illustration transports us into a world where simplicity meets beauty; where rural life intertwines with theatricality. It invites us to imagine ourselves as spectators witnessing this enchanting moment unfold before our eyes.
